“Expiration Date being past the Required Date” issue for Batch Number in D365 Finance & Operations.

In Dynamics 365 Finance and Operations (D365 F&O), the use of batch numbers is a common practice to manage and trace items with specific characteristics. Batch numbers are typically assigned to groups of items produced or received together, allowing for better control, tracking, and compliance with industry regulations.
